Изменение шаблона команды выполнения скрипта через СМС

Тема в разделе "Скрипты", создана пользователем ksvsv, 22 янв 2020.

  1. ksvsv

    ksvsv Новый участник

    Здравствуйте.
    Может кто занимался изучением вопроса...

    Возможно ли поменять шаблон команды обращения к микротику через СМС?

    Есть микротик, в него воткнут модем с симкой, скрипты выполняются, все работает хорошо. НО было бы удобней отдавать команды микротику через смс более удобным текстом.

    Сейчас шаблон выглядит так:
    :cmd "пароль" script "имя скрипта"
    Хочу его изменить...
     
  2. Илья Князев

    Илья Князев Администратор Команда форума

    Так напишите, что-то типа
    "Если текст в SMS такой-то, то сделать то-то"
     
  3. ksvsv

    ksvsv Новый участник

    Здравствуйте.
    Можете пояснить... Каким тогда образом будет запускаться скрипт, который должен проверять содержимое смс?
    или, например, сделать шедулер, который будет запускаться раз в 30 сек и смотреть?

    Приведите, пожалуйста, пример такого скрипта... Он, наверное, будет вида: /tool sms inbox find message но дальше не пойму как... сообщение не ищет, значение не возвращает.
     
  4. Илья Князев

    Илья Князев Администратор Команда форума

  5. ksvsv

    ksvsv Новый участник

    Спасибо за ссылку, но не выходит :-(
    Проблема, наверное, заключается в том, что микротик не работает с смс когда создается lte интрефейс... т.е. с прошивкой HiLink. Так же полностью не работает инструментал /tools sms.
    Когда пытаешь поставить галку "Receive enebled" на lte интерфейс, то сразу получаем ошибку "modem unsupported".
    т.о. модем прекрасно работает, интернет раздает, но функционал sms не работает...
    И если использовать скрипт, ссылку на который Вы дали, ошибка "modem unsupported" вылетает сразу после выполнения первой строчки /interface lte at-chat lte1 input="AT+CMGF=1"

    Для того, что бы работал функционал /tools sms (отправка и прием сообщений) я специально модем прошивал в прошивку stick, который при подключении создает интерфейс ppp-out1.

    Или, может быть, я что то не так понимаю? Дайте совет, пожалуйста.
    Может быть, бывают модемы, которые работают корректно? Сейчас использую самые обычные модемы Huawei E3372
     
    Последнее редактирование: 11 фев 2020
  6. Илья Князев

    Илья Князев Администратор Команда форума

    Да именно так.
     
  7. ksvsv

    ksvsv Новый участник

    Получается, что скрипт на обычных usb модемах lte работать не будет?
    В скрипте, написано, что он использует модем Huawei me909... и он с другим интерфейсом подключения.